For some time now I've been meaning to do something about the front suspension as it sits very low on the front and potholes now have to be avoided. 2002 Hymer B694G on Fiat 2.8 JTD 5000kgs gross weight and running at 4500kgs or more most of the time.
So I know a few on here have had this done so need advice on where to buy replacement springs and top plates, the guys who do my work can fit easily as they specialise in HGVs.

Euro Car Parts can supply heavy duty coil springs and top mounts. On a 12 year old vehicle its probably worth replacing the struts as well. Its a job we've done several times and it makes a marked improvement to roadholding and drive comfort. Standard coils have a wire thickness of 19mm, heavy duty is 21mm.
